Diversity, Inclusivity, and Antiracism Task Force During spring quarter, the Diversity, Inclusivity, and Antiracism Task Force has met with campus constituents, and reviewed relevant documentation (such as Senate Bill 5227, survey results from the Office of Diversity and Inclusivity’s 2018 Campus Climate Survey, and the Diversity and Equity Center’s Antiracism Workshop). The committee also created the listening session schedule, scripts, and slides for different constituent groups, and a survey for faculty/staff, and one for students. There were two listening sessions for the following stakeholders: Students, Faculty, Open session; and three listening sessions for Staff. A total of 186 participants attended the listening sessions. As of May 4 th , there are 267 responses to the Faculty/Staff Survey and 151 responses to the Student Survey. The committee will now work on preliminary analysis of all the data and collaborate with Academic Affairs to craft a motion for consideration at the June 2 nd Faculty Senate meeting. Fall 2021 Opening Plans The Faculty Senate Executive Committee has been working with the administration on opening plans for Fall 2021. With several other universities, including WSU and UW, stating they intend to require vaccines for students in the fall, CWU continues to monitor and track the situation. This effort includes working with the governor’s office to understand if a statewide mandate for vaccines at higher education institutions is forthcoming. In addition, work is underway to outline health and safety guidelines for students, faculty, and staff. Once those are developed, they will be shared with all. In addition, information about cleaning protocols in classrooms, offices, and common areas as well as air circulation is being compiled and will be shared with faculty and staff.
